Stunning good sized junior 4 located right between queens blvd and austin street. The unit is on the 4th floor of a 7 story elevator building. The apartment faces the front of the building with views of the gorgeous views of Tudor style homes. The apartment   has a generous foyer with a massive closet. The living room is large.
 
 The junior room is located by the kitchen and living room. The kitchen was recently updated with the bathroom. The quartz countertop, plenty of cabinetry, dishwasher, stove, fridge, and microwave are great additions to this kitchen.
 
 The bathroom was tiled floor to ceiling with a contemporary look.  
 
 The primary bedroom is large and has two closets.
 
 The building highlights 24/7 surveillance, free bike storage, storage lockers, 24/7 laundry, live-in super and porter.

FOREST HILLS

Forest Hills is a lush, beautiful residential neighborhood in the middle of Queens. Surrounded by many neighborhoods including Corona, Rego Park, and Kew Gardens, Forest Hills leans more into the suburban lifestyle rather than a gritty city one. The houses are big, the shopping is plentiful, and the people who live here never run out of things to do.

Fun Facts and History of Forest Hills

In the early days, Forest Hills was made up of six large farms. In 1895, the area just beneath those farms was being transformed into a park known as Forest Park. In 1906, developers bought the six large farmlands in order to develop them into a neighborhood, which would be named Forest Hills as a tribute to the neighboring park.
